Safety information • Do not locate multiple portable socket-outlets or portable power supplies at the rear of the appliance. Installation cautions CAUTION • Allow sufficient space around the refrigerator and install it on a flat surface. - Keep the ventilation space in the appliance enclosure or mounting structure clear of obstructions. • After the refrigerator has been installed and turned on, let it stand for 2 hours before loading it with food. • It is strongly recommended you have a qualified technician or service company install the refrigerator. - Failing to do so may result in an electric shock, fire, explosion, problems with the product, or injury. • Overloading the refrigerator door may cause the refrigerator to fall, causing physical injury. Critical usage warnings WARNING • Do not insert the power plug into a wall socket with wet hands. - This may result in an electric shock. • Do not store articles on the top of the appliance. - When you open or close the door, the articles may fall and cause personal injury and/or material damage. • Do not insert hands, feet, or metal objects (such as chopsticks, etc.) into the bottom or into the back of the refrigerator. - This may result in an electric shock or injury. - Any sharp edges may cause a personal injury. • Do not touch the inside walls of the freezer or products stored in the freezer with wet hands. - This may cause frostbite. • Do not put a container filled with water on the refrigerator. - If spilled, there is a risk of fire or electric shock. • Do not keep volatile or flammable objects or substances (benzene, thinner, propane gas, alcohol, ether, LP gas, and other such products) in the refrigerator. - This refrigerator is for storing food only. - This may result in fire or explosion. • Children should be supervised to ensure that they do not play with the appliance. - Keep fingers out of "pinch point" areas. Clearances between the doors and cabinet are necessarily small. Be careful when you open the doors if children are in the area. • Do not let children hang on the door or door bins.
